Go Green Pilot 2012

We are looking for 12 students in their second or third year who are passionate about the environment and wish to do their dissertations / academic projects while gaining a work experience with third sector organisations located in Cambridge. It is a great opportunity to gain training in eco-auditing, get a meaningful work experience; enhance your chances to participate in the green job market; meet interesting people and to participate of the many activities we are planning including workshops, parties, conferences, possibility of writing articles, and many more!

You will have to prepare a 1 minute video, showing us why you are enthusiastic about the environment and why you want to participate in this pilot. Be creative, songs, music, art or a honest heartfelt approach are welcome! Also you need to send a CV. Emails in the flyer attached. A group of experts (including the organisations you will be working with) will select the students who will be invited for a sort of "green apprentice" type of interview.

This is a great opportunity to gain employment experience and to combine academic work with practice. You will receive a certificate for training as an eco-auditor and you will be part of an academic team for research and scholarship. I was involved in the pioneering group of students who started this idea. last year and it provided me with the platform to base my dissertation on and develop my skills of working in a team both in and out of the professional organisation. 

Former students have improved their employment opportunities in graduate jobs and promotions. Indeed, this is a very innovative project and it is really fun to participate, and we hope you can also become a mentor for future students!
